Celil, a Turkish rendering of Jalil, comes from the same Arabic root j-l-l as Celal, the root behind Al-Jalil.

Reference Profile

Etymology

The Turkish form of the Arabic jalil, 'majestic, exalted' - among the descriptive names of God.

Islamic Significance

The root appears in the divine epithet Dhul-Jalal wal-Ikram, Possessor of Majesty and Honour, which closes the Surah of the Merciful (55:27).

Cultural / Regional Usage

Used across Turkish-influenced Muslim communities.
